Explain the concept of a system model and its role in software development.
Q: Discuss the evolution of operating systems and the challenges of developing modern, secure, and…
A: The purpose of an operating system (OS) is to facilitate the efficient use of resources and the…
Q: Explain the concept of network-attached storage (NAS) and its benefits in a distributed environment.
A: NAS stands for Network Attached Storage. It is a collection of storage devices that can be used to…
Q: Discuss the role of data flow diagrams in modeling a system's data flow and transformation…
A: Data Flow Diagrams (DFDs) are visual tools used in systems analysis and design to model how data…
Q: What is orthographic projection in computer graphics and visualization?
A: The objective of the question is to understand the concept of orthographic projection in the field…
Q: What challenges and solutions are associated with data migration and portability between different…
A: In this question we have to understand about challenges and solutions are associated with data…
Q: What is the role of distributed consensus algorithms like ZooKeeper in distributed system…
A: Distributed consensus algorithms, such as Zookeeper play a role in coordinating and managing…
Q: Discuss the memory management strategies employed by different operating systems.
A: An Operating System (OS) is the foundational software that manages hardware resources and provides a…
Q: Explain the role of data deduplication in optimizing storage space and reducing data redundancy in…
A: The most common way of duplicating data across a few storage locales to ensure data integrity and…
Q: Discuss the challenges of designing distributed systems and how they are addressed by different…
A: In the dynamic realm of modern computing, the design of distributed systems stands as a formidable…
Q: Explain the concepts of virtualization and containerization, and their differences.
A: In the field of computer science, virtualization and containerization are two ways to manage and…
Q: Investigate the energy-efficient multiprocessing strategies employed in wearable devices and IoT…
A: Wearable gadgets and Internet of Things (IoT) sensors have become essential pieces of our day-to-day…
Q: Discuss the different editions of Windows operating systems and their targeted use cases.
A: In the context of computer technology and operating systems, the term "Windows" refers to a series…
Q: Analyze the factors that influence the choice of an appropriate operating system for a specific…
A: An appropriate operating system is a important decision that affects the functionality and user…
Q: Explain the concept of user accounts and permissions in Windows, emphasizing the principles of least…
A: User accounts and permissions are fundamental aspects of Windows operating systems that play a…
Q: What is the purpose of a storage controller in storage devices, and how does it impact data transfer…
A: A peripheral or piece of hardware used to read, write, store, and manage data in a computer system…
Q: What are the advantages and challenges of implementing microservices in a distributed system?
A: In software development micro services architecture is an approach where a complex application is…
Q: Discuss the different user authentication methods supported by Windows, including passwords, smart…
A: User authentication is the process of verifying the identity of a person or entity seeking access to…
Q: Explain the role of a message broker in facilitating communication and coordination in distributed…
A: A message broker assumes a urgent part in improving communication and coordination inside…
Q: What is classic viewing in computer graphics and visualization?
A: Classic viewing in computer graphics and visualization refers to the traditional methods used to…
Q: How does load balancing contribute to the efficiency of distributed systems? Provide examples.
A: Load balancing is a concept, in the field of distributed systems in the context of Computer Science…
Q: . Create the Carpet calculator • Ask for the length, and width of the room Calculate the number of…
A: Start.Create a Scanner object for user input.Prompt the user to enter the length and width of a room…
Q: Describe the role of middleware in facilitating communication in distributed systems.
A: Middleware plays a role in facilitating communication within distributed systems.These systems…
Q: Explain the concept of Active Directory in a Windows network environment.
A: Active Directory (AD) is a directory service and identity management system developed by Microsoft…
Q: Explore the optimization techniques for client-side caching in web applications with dynamic…
A: Client-side caching plays a crucial role in enhancing the performance and user experience of web…
Q: Discuss the importance of data lifecycle management and its impact on storage efficiency.
A: Data Lifecycle Management (DLM) is a critical aspect of efficiently managing data throughout its…
Q: Explain the use of the MapReduce paradigm in processing large-scale data in distributed systems.
A: The Map Reduce paradigm is a programming model and processing framework specifically designed for…
Q: Explain the concept of over-provisioning in SSDs and its role in maintaining performance and…
A: Over provisioning in SSDs refers to distributing storage capacity beyond what is advertised.This…
Q: Euclid's Game starts with two unequal positive numbers on the board. For this problem, assume that…
A: As described in the question the Euclid's game is a strategy oriented game. The key to winning this…
Q: What precautions should be taken when managing driver updates and installation on Windows systems to…
A: In the dynamic landscape of Windows systems, ensuring the seamless integration of driver updates is…
Q: Analyze the trade-offs between concurrency, security, and performance in system model design.
A: When designing a system model, it is crucial to consider the tradeoffs between concurrency,…
Q: Explore emerging storage technologies and their potential impact on the industry.
A: Storage technologies play a pivotal role in shaping the efficiency and capabilities of digital…
Q: Evaluate the effectiveness of different system modeling techniques in addressing specific software…
A: System modeling techniques are pivotal in software development, offering solutions to diverse…
Q: Describe the functions and features of Windows Resource Monitor in monitoring system resources and…
A: Windows Resource Monitor is a tool built into the Windows operating system that gives users an…
Q: Explore the role of power cables in computer systems, emphasizing the importance of proper cable…
A: Computer systems are firm gatherings of peripherals, software, and hardware that cooperate to do…
Q: Hello, can you please help me with this. It's in Marie language. Please make sure that the commands…
A: This program exemplifies the quintessential "Hello, World!" demonstration, a tradition in…
Q: Describe the key phases of the prototyping model of system development.
A: The prototyping model is a method for developing systems that allows for ongoing user involvement…
Q: Describe the process management and scheduling mechanisms in various operating systems.
A: Process management and scheduling play roles, in operating systems ensuring that resources are used…
Q: Explain the concept of a distributed database and its advantages.
A: Distributed Database Management System is referred to as DDBMS. It is a software program that…
Q: Explore the use of optical fiber cables for high-speed data transfer and network connectivity.
A: Computer Networking refers to the practice of connecting multiple computing devices, such as…
Q: Investigate the energy efficiency gains achieved through multiprocessing in mobile operating…
A: When it comes to operating systems multiprocessing refers to the execution of multiple tasks or…
Q: Q4\ Draw a flowchart to sum the even numbers between 0 and 59.
A: StartSet totalSum = 0Set number = 0While number <= 59 If number is even Add number to…
Q: Discuss the benefits of fiber-optic cables over copper cables for long-distance data transmission.
A: Fiber-optic cables are communication cables made of thin strands of plastic fibers or glass that…
Q: Q1\Write a java program that read student name and four marks form the keyboard. Then, it determines…
A: Here is your solution -
Q: Explore the emerging trends in system modeling, such as model-driven development and cloud-based…
A: In the realm of Computer Science Engineering the field is greatly influenced by emerging trends, in…
Q: Elaborate on the role of crossover cables in direct network connections between devices.
A: A Direct Network Connection typically refers to a connection established between two devices without…
Q: Discuss the advancements in submarine fiber optic cables and their role in global communication…
A: Submarine fiber optic cables are a part of today’s communication networks.These cables, which are…
Q: Discuss the principles of software-defined storage (SDS) and its advantages in abstracting storage…
A: Let us explore the principles of Software Defined Storage (SDS).SDS is an approach to managing…
Q: Explain the Windows Event Viewer and its use in tracking system events and diagnosing issues.
A: The Windows Event Viewer is a tool in the Windows operating system that allows users to see and keep…
Q: Describe the mechanisms used by operating systems for file management and I/O operations.
A: The system software that acts as a bridge between computer hardware and the software programs that…
Q: Describe the key components and features of Windows Remote Desktop Services (RDS) for enabling…
A: In the ever-evolving landscape of digital connectivity, Windows Remote Desktop Services (RDS) stands…
Explain the concept of a system model and its role in software development.
Step by step
Solved in 3 steps
- Explain the concept of a system model and its importance in software development.The field of software engineering places significant emphasis on the process of software development.Explain the concept of design patterns in software development. Give examples of three common design patterns and explain when to use each.
- Explain the concept of software architecture and its significance in software development.Explain the concept of design patterns in software development. Provide examples of a few design patterns and their use cases.Explain the concept of software architecture and its importance in software development.